Christina

Christina has been skating since childhood, and what began as play became her peace. She is a Certified Skate Instructor and Resident Instructor at her local rink, where she has a special passion for teaching beginners in a supportive and welcoming environment. Christina uses skating as a tool to help build confidence while supporting mental and physical health, joy, and self-expression. She is passionate about helping students of all ages discover skating as a creative and artistic outlet—whether as a new hobby or as something meaningful that supports their life journey.
